探索Android开发:SQLite通讯录项目推荐
去发现同类优质开源项目:https://gitcode.com/
项目介绍
在移动应用开发的世界中,通讯录功能是每个开发者都会接触到的基础模块。本项目是一个简单的Android应用程序,专注于展示如何使用SQLite数据库在Android平台上实现一个基本的通讯录功能。无论你是Android开发的初学者,还是希望深入了解SQLite数据库在Android中的应用,这个项目都将为你提供宝贵的学习资源。
项目技术分析
技术栈
- Android SDK:作为Android应用开发的核心工具,Android SDK提供了构建和运行Android应用所需的所有API和工具。
- SQLite:SQLite是一个轻量级的嵌入式数据库,非常适合在移动设备上存储和管理数据。在本项目中,SQLite被用作本地数据库,存储联系人信息。
- Java:作为Android开发的主要编程语言,Java在本项目中被广泛使用,从UI设计到数据库操作,Java代码贯穿整个应用。
功能实现
- 联系人管理:项目实现了联系人的基本管理功能,包括添加、删除、修改和查询联系人信息。这些操作通过SQLite数据库进行持久化存储,确保数据的安全性和可靠性。
- 界面设计:应用界面简洁直观,操作流程清晰,即使是初学者也能轻松上手。
项目及技术应用场景
学习场景
- 初学者入门:对于刚刚接触Android开发的初学者,这个项目是一个绝佳的起点。通过学习如何集成SQLite数据库,你可以掌握Android应用开发的基本流程和核心技术。
- 数据库操作:如果你希望深入了解SQLite数据库在Android中的应用,这个项目将为你提供丰富的实践经验。
实际应用
- 通讯录应用:虽然本项目是一个简单的通讯录实现,但它可以作为一个基础模板,用于开发更复杂的通讯录应用。你可以在此基础上扩展功能,如添加联系人分组、导入导出联系人等。
- 数据管理:SQLite在Android应用中广泛用于本地数据存储和管理。通过学习本项目,你可以掌握如何在Android应用中高效地使用SQLite数据库。
项目特点
- 简单易用:项目代码结构清晰,功能实现简洁明了,非常适合初学者学习和参考。
- 实用性强:通讯录功能是每个移动应用中都会涉及的基础模块,通过学习本项目,你可以快速掌握相关技术,并应用到实际开发中。
- 开源社区支持:本项目采用MIT许可证,欢迎开发者提交问题和改进建议,共同完善项目。你不仅可以学习,还可以参与到开源社区的贡献中。
无论你是Android开发的新手,还是希望进一步提升SQLite数据库应用技能的开发者,这个项目都值得你一试。下载项目,导入Android Studio,开始你的Android开发之旅吧!
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



